The Hall was built in 1957 by public subscription and is named in memory of the men of the Parish who died in the two World Wars and as such the Hall is a registered War Memorial. At the time of its construction the Parish had used an ex-army WW I hut as a Village Hall, a replacement was urgently needed, so in spite of the restrictions at the time, land was given and the money raised. The original purpose of the Hall has remained true over the years and still today is the focal point in the Parish for meetings, events and entertainment.It has excellent acoustics and has one of the finest sprung dance floors in the district. The Hall is a registered charity with a volunteer management committee responsible for raising its own funds to cover all maintenance and day to day running costs, which in a building some 60 years old is no mean feat. The committee are always interesting in welcoming new members who can bring different strengths to the group. The Hall has weekday classes for fitness, dancing and special interest groups and is the venue for children’s parties, quiz nights, public meetings, live entertainment, local amateur dramatic groups and as a polling station for elections.

The main entrance is off Station Road which it fronts.

The Hall has an extensive stage area with range of lighting units, available to hire under special conditions. Parking for up to approx. 30 cars. Ladies, Gents and disabled access toilets are situated in the entrance lobby.

The main hall is 15mtrs (50 foot) x 9.5mtrs (30ft.) usable working height 4mtrs (14ft)The refurbished kitchen is 5.75mtrs (19ft.) x 3mtrs (9ft) and is provided with a large fridge, hot water urn, kettle,small microwave, large 4 ring gas cooker with oven. Crockery and cutlery for up to 15 people is provided, additional items can be hired at a very modest cost. The hall has seating for up to 120 people and can comfortably accommodate up to 100 seated at tables. We have 12 large 1.8mtrs (6.6ft) x 760 (30”) and 10 small760 x 760 (30” x 30”) folding tables.

The Meeting Room:
Refurbished in 2017 it has it’s own dedicated side access,(not disabled friendly) lobby with unisex toilet, facilities for drink making (15 cups and kettle provided) the main room is 5.75mtrs (19ft) x 3mtrs (9ft) and is ideal for up to 15 people, tables and chairs.
